The number (x) in: "2 more than three times a number is 326" is what we are solving here.
In other words, you are looking for a number (x) that if you multiply it by three (same as three times) and then add 2, you get 326.
To solve this, you first write the problem as an algebra equation as follows: 3x + 2 = 326
Then you solve the equation by subtracting 2 from both sides, and then divide both sides by 3. Here is the math to
illustrate better:
3x + 2 = 326
3x + 2 - 2 = 326 - 2
3x = 324
3x/3 = 324/3
x = 108
Answer = 108
